Drivers face new $750 fines under the ‘Paws Act’ as officials launch crackdown to protect animals on roads

DRIVERS could face a new steep $750 fine under a proposed legislation aimed at protecting pets on the street.

Lawmakers in New York City have introduced the Paws Act, a bill seeking to punish drivers and repeat offenders who harm or kill service animals or pets while on the road.

Currently, road laws in the Big Apple protect pedestrians, cyclists, and animals such as sheep, cattle, and goats.

But now, city officials are looking to pass a new enhanced bill dubbed the Paws Act, which stands for Protecting Animals Walking on the Street.

Under the proposed legislation, penalties against offenders would increase when a driver injures or kills a pet.

“Over one million pets call New York home, and they play an important role in our lives, whether they be service animals, guide dogs, or just members of the family,” New York State Senator Andrew Goundares said.

“But right now, our traffic law treats them like disposable property.

“The Paws Acts recognizes the dignity and value of these nonhuman New Yorkers, and ensures our laws send a clear message to reckless drivers: paws your vehicle to let pets pass.”

The proposed bill would increase the maximum penalty from $100 to $500 for striking a pet and leaving the scene for first-time offenders.

The legislation would also increase the minimum fine from $50 to $00 for a second violation.

The maximum fine under the bill would also rise from $150 to $750 for a second-time offense.

Drivers involved in hit-and-run incidents involving a service or guide dog would see the minimum fine go up from $50 to $250 for a first-time violation.

“Pets are much more than just animals,” New York Senator Brad Hoylman-Sigal said.

“They are companions, members of our families, and in the case of service animals they are a crucial resource that disabled New Yorkers need to live their everyday lives.

“But right now the lives of those animals are dramatically undervalued and as a result they are suffering from the same traffic violence that is plaguing all New Yorkers but getting none of the attention or legal protection humans get.”

Hoylman-Sigal added, “That changes with the Paws Act, which will increase the penalties for injuries or killing companion animals in car crashes.”

Pet owner Jason Dilmanian underscored the importance of including scooters and electric bikes in the list of potential offenders who could face fines.

“It’s not just cars, it could be any kind of vehicle, it could be scooters, electric bikes, but with some of those vehicles especially, people can be reckless, but also with cars,” Dilmanian told ABC affiliate WABC-TV.

“The fact that the penalty was so low if someone were to hit or kill a dog, that was really surprising.”

The bill is expected to be voted on in the next legislative session in 2025.

“Our pets are members of our family,” Assembly Member Harvey Epstein said.

“Nearly every day for the past 10 years, I have walked my rescue dog Homer through the East Village.

“Reckless driving endangers their lives and the current penalties do not adequately account for the damage done.

“Especially for people with disabilities, these animals are a lifeline and the penalties for harming one should be more than the price of a parking ticket.”

Brodie Brazil and Bip Roberts both break down live on CBS Sports after emotional Oakland A’s final home game

THE Oakland A’s final home game was filled with emotion, and even the broadcasters couldn’t hold in their tears.

The Athletics are moving out of the city after this season despite pleas from fans to keep the team.

The plans are to relocate the A’s to Las Vegas eventually, but they will play in Sacramento, California until their Vegas stadium is complete.

The A’s current home, the Oakland Coliseum, was sold out with over 40,000 fans to say goodbye to their beloved team.

In a storybook ending, the A’s won their final game in Oakland and shared a tearful goodbye with fans after the game.

Oakland A’s analysts Brodie Brazil and Bip Roberts were tasked with breaking down the action from the day after the game, but couldn’t do much else than cry.

“This is not easy,” Brazil said.

“You’re a baseball guy, I should be asking you about double plays and hitters going the other way.

“But we’re also Bay Area people, born and raised in the East Bay. You’re a community guy from Oakland.

“What’s your initial takeaway on how today played out?”

All Roberts could do was reach for a tissue and hold his head in his hands while he cried.

“That’s all I got for you bro,” he said with his head in his hands.

MLB fans have been in outrage ever since it was announced that the A’s would move out of Oakland, and fans haven’t ceased their outcry.

“Gotta give Oakland props. They showed up, represented and gave their best. I hope MLB sees this and gets the message,” one fan said.

“Oakland deserves better,” another fan said.

“Yankees fan here and I feel bad for all the A’s fans today. Such a sad day,” a third fan said.

“Bip has me in tears on this post-game,” a fourth fan said.
